Awarding of Defence contracts 'sloppy' but not fraudulent: inquiry

29 Aug 2011

Source: News.com.au


A Parliamentary inquiry has declared aspects of the tender process, when awarding contracts to transport Australian troops to and from the Middle East, ‘sloppy’ but not fraudulent.

"Defence was notably inattentive when it came to identifying and managing probity risks, especially conflicts of interest," the Senate’s foreign affairs defence and trade committee said in its report, tabled in the Senate.

"Thus a cloud of uncertainty lingers over the integrity of this tender."
